MY LADY MACBETH MOMENT?
By Neel Anil Panicker
Look at it__a tweenie weenie porcelain doll, a mere statue that sits all day long astride my glass top table near the window that opens to the sea.
All it does is grin, and rather cheekily at that.
But, is that all? Or, is it that appearances are deceptive?
Does Al and this doll have a connection?
No?
Then why is that ever since Al’s leaving all I see in that miniature Queen Victoria look alike with a delectable chocolate cake of a hat that all but covers her golden brown crowning glory is a priest strumming a violin?
Why is that such thoughts turn even more macabre as the night turns inwards?
And why the hell do I also see blood?
Yes, you heard that__real human blood streaming out of those big black buttons that pass off for her eyes?
Why? why? And hell! even more whys?
Is it because I know that Al’s not coming back ever is all due to me?
That I have his blood on my hands?
